The Victory Day celebration, which has irritated Washington and was held for the first time in Serbia at the state level under the decree of President Aleksandar Vucic, is in line with the sentiments of the local population, which supports an alliance with Moscow and rejects pro-Western politicians.

Admiral Vladimir Solovyov, former intelligence chief of the Russian Black Sea Fleet, told PolitNavigator about this.

Let us remind you that the day before several signals were received at once, indicating Washington’s dissatisfaction with the celebrations of Victory Day in Serbia, which was celebrated for the first time at the state level according to the decree of President Aleksandar Vucic. Russian politicians, social activists and military personnel took part in the events.

The American Associated Press agency emphasized that the military parade held in Serbia with the participation of Russian equipment should be assessed as a demonstration of force in the situation of a new round of tension around Kosovo.

As PolitNavigator reported, the negotiations on the fate of Kosovo that took place the other day in Berlin did not bring any results - the leadership of the Albanian separatists refused to search for a compromise solution and demanded that their patrons from the United States be involved in the negotiations.

Meanwhile, the Kosovo separatist authorities began negotiations on creation of a “mini-Schengen” with Albania. Observers consider this a forerunner of the Greater Albania project.

During a visit to Moscow, Serbian Defense Minister Alexander Vulin said that NATO is arming Albanian terrorists.

The United States needs the Greater Albania project in order to have control over transport and energy corridors in the Balkans, say representatives of the Serbian Foreign Ministry.

In recent months, street protests by local opposition have intensified in Serbia demanding the overthrow of President Aleksandar Vucic. According to observers, the street protests are incited by the West to pressure on the Serbian authorities during negotiations on the fate of Kosovo.
